Margie "Marge" Estelle Daoust
April 19, 1933 - January 21, 2022
Margie "Marge" Estelle Daoust, age 88, of Gloucester, peacefully passed away on Friday, January 21, 2022. Margie enjoyed spending time with her family, fishing, cooking, telling old stories, and cutting up hog meat with her friends at Twin Spring Farm. Those who had the pleasure of knowing Margie best describe her as a woman with a heart of gold and often recall her favorite phrase, "Watcha doin?" She is preceded in death by her husband, Harold J. Daoust, Sr., first husband, James W. Hudgins, Sr., daughter Susie P. Hudgins, parents Pauline and James C. Bonniville, siblings Abbit, Petty, Stanley, James, and Lucy "Doll Baby." She is survived by her children, Margie E. Smith (Danny), James W. Hudgins, Jr. (Vicky), Calvin J. Daoust (Ellen), and Tammy K. Daoust. Ten grandchildren, seven great-grandchildren, two great-great-grandchildren, and siblings Mary Ann (Buddy) and Clarence (Barbara). She will be greatly missed by all that knew her, especially by her granddaughter Nikki and husband Ricky Hartford, great-granddaughter Savanna, "nanny's tadpole," and special grandkids Heather (Qiana), Kelly, Billy, Jacob, Brittany, and Charity, special son-in-law Scotty Gsell, special niece Barbara Kellum (B.B.) and special friend Rosalie Corbin. On Wednesday, January 26, 2022, the family will receive friends at Hogg Funeral Home from 6:00 until 7:30 pm. Thursday, January 27, 2022, a graveside service officiated by Curtis Walker will be held at Beulah Baptist Church Cemetery, 5490 Ware Neck Road, Gloucester. Services under the direction of Hogg Funeral Home.
